Summit Serenity: Großer Arber Peak

Großer Arber, the majestic highest point in the Bavarian Forest, rises to an impressive 1,456 meters above sea level, offering panoramic views that stretch far beyond the horizon. This iconic peak is a beloved destination for tourists and nature enthusiasts alike, drawing visitors with its stunning landscapes and diverse hiking trails suitable for all skill levels. The area is rich in natural beauty, featuring lush forests, rocky outcrops, and a variety of wildlife, making it a perfect spot for photography and outdoor activities. As you approach the summit, you'll encounter well-marked hiking paths that wind through the picturesque surroundings, allowing you to immerse yourself in the tranquility of nature. In addition to hiking, Großer Arber offers opportunities for skiing and snowboarding in the winter months, transforming the region into a winter wonderland. For those who prefer a more leisurely visit, there are cozy mountain lodges where you can enjoy local cuisine and warm beverages while taking in the breathtaking views. Getting There

  • Car

    If you are traveling by car, start your journey from any location in Šumava. Navigate to the nearest major road leading to Bayerisch Eisenstein. From there, take the B11 road towards Bayerisch Eisenstein. Follow the signs towards Großer Arber. Once you reach the parking area at the foot of the mountain, you will need to park your car. Parking fees may be applicable, typically around €5 for the day.

  • Hiking

    From the parking area, embark on the hiking trail that leads to the Großer Arber Gipfelkreuz. The hike is approximately 2.5 kilometers and will take about 1-1.5 hours. The trail is well-marked, and you will encounter beautiful views along the way. Ensure you have appropriate hiking gear and water.

  • Public Transportation

    If you prefer public transport, take a bus from major towns in Šumava to Bayerisch Eisenstein. Check the local bus schedules for routes and timings. Once you arrive in Bayerisch Eisenstein, you can either walk to the base of Großer Arber or take a local taxi to the parking area. Bus fares typically range from €2-€5 depending on the distance.

  • Cable Car

    Alternatively, you can use the cable car service that operates from the base of Großer Arber to the summit area. This is a convenient option especially during the winter months. The cable car ride costs approximately €10 for a round trip. After reaching the top, you can enjoy a short walk to the Gipfelkreuz, which is situated at 1,456m above sea level.
